I hope  you all answer to be prepared.

Whether it is a weather emergency, a sickness, or another unforeseen event I hope that you all are doing something which will help you in times of need. 

Coming up on winter where I live, it can be nasty, frozen & unforgiving so we keep some things on hand in case we cant get out. Sickness we've had those times as well, couldn't make it to the store.

Canned Soup, crackers, & ginger ale for when the stomach bug comes, ginger tea. 

Hoarding is not what this is....this is be ready.....

those few items in a sickness or weather situation will be most welcome I assure  you. You have time now to purchase these items, plan for an event. 

You plan for holidays, birthdays, etc...why not plan for an event you didn't plan on?
